#ed1c02 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#ed1c02 is composed of 92.9% red, 11%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 88.2% magenta, 99.2% yellow and 7.1% black. It has a hue angle of 6.6 degrees, a saturation of 98.3% and a lightness of 46.9%. #ed1c02 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ff3804 with #db0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ff3300.

Shades and Tints of #ed1c02
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040000 is the darkest color, while #fff1ef is the lightest one.

Tones of #ed1c02
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7f7270 is the less saturated color, while #ed1c02 is the most saturated one.
